Born in Laurel, Neb., on Aug. 31, 1928, Coburn grew up in Compton and majored in acting at Los Angeles City College. Coburn served a stint with the United States Military as a public information officer and following his discharge he continued his acting training in New York under the mentorship of Stella Adler. Coburn remained an active performer in spite of suffering from the crippling effects of rheumatoid arthritis. After a decade under the shadow of the disease, Coburn claimed to have been cured by a dietary supplement pill based on sulphur.
